1. Embossing
Embossing is prime to the performance of a army canine tag machine. The method creates raised characters on skinny metallic plates, guaranteeing the crucial info on the tags stays legible regardless of harsh situations. This sturdiness is essential for identification in fight or catastrophe eventualities the place tags is likely to be uncovered to grime, water, or injury. The raised characters additionally enable for tactile studying in low-light situations or when visible inspection is tough. A soldier’s canine tag, recovered from a battlefield a long time after a battle, nonetheless clearly displaying embossed info as a result of strong nature of the method, exemplifies the enduring legibility offered by embossing.
The embossing course of itself usually entails making use of strain to the metallic plate utilizing hardened dies formed to kind letters, numbers, and symbols. This deforms the metallic, making a raised impression. Completely different machines make the most of various mechanisms, from handbook lever presses to automated, computerized methods. Whatever the particular mechanism, the precept of deformation below strain stays constant. The readability and depth of the embossing immediately affect the tag’s long-term readability, highlighting the significance of exact strain and die alignment through the course of. Fashionable machines usually incorporate options like automated character spacing and alignment to make sure constant, high-quality embossing.

4. Sturdiness
Sturdiness is a crucial issue for army canine tag machines and the tags they produce. These machines and the identification they supply should stand up to the pains of army service, usually in demanding environments. This necessitates strong building and using resilient supplies to make sure long-term performance and readability of the embossed info.
-
Materials Resilience
The metallic plates used for canine tags should resist corrosion, bending, and breakage. Widespread supplies embody stainless-steel and monel, chosen for his or her resistance to environmental elements and put on. A tag remaining legible after extended publicity to saltwater demonstrates materials resilience. This resilience ensures the tag stays a dependable identifier even below harsh situations.

Often Requested Questions
This part addresses frequent inquiries concerning army canine tag machines, offering concise and informative responses.
Query 1: What info is often embossed on army canine tags?
Commonplace info contains final identify, first identify, center preliminary, social safety quantity (or service quantity), blood sort, and non secular choice (if desired). Particular necessities might fluctuate by nation and army department.
Query 2: What supplies are generally used for canine tags?
Tags are usually made from corrosion-resistant metals comparable to stainless-steel or monel. These supplies guarantee sturdiness and legibility in harsh environments.
Query 3: Are there various kinds of canine tag machines?
Machines vary from easy handbook units to stylish computerized methods. The selection is dependent upon elements comparable to manufacturing quantity, required precision, and portability wants.
Query 4: How does the embossing course of work?
Embossing entails deforming the metallic tag below strain utilizing hardened dies formed to kind letters, numbers, and symbols. This creates raised characters for sturdiness and readability.
Query 5: How is standardization maintained in canine tag manufacturing?
Army rules dictate particular requirements for knowledge fields, tag dimensions, materials composition, and embossing codecs. This ensures uniformity and interoperability.
Query 6: The place are canine tag machines usually used?
Machines are utilized in numerous settings, from recruitment facilities and army bases to area hospitals and cellular deployment models. Portability is usually an important think about machine choice.

Ideas for Efficient Canine Tag Embossing
Guaranteeing clear and sturdy embossing is essential for the performance of army identification tags. The following pointers supply sensible steering for attaining optimum outcomes with a canine tag machine.
Tip 1: Correct Materials Choice: Make the most of specified metallic plates designed for embossing. Materials hardness and thickness immediately affect embossing readability and longevity. Deciding on acceptable supplies ensures optimum outcomes and tag sturdiness. For instance, stainless-steel and monel supply wonderful corrosion resistance and embossing retention.
Tip 2: Correct Information Entry: Confirm all info earlier than embossing. Errors can render tags unusable, necessitating pricey and time-consuming replacements. Double-checking knowledge accuracy is important for minimizing errors and guaranteeing tag validity.
Tip 3: Appropriate Machine Adjustment: Correct character spacing and alignment are crucial for legibility. Seek the advice of the machine’s working handbook for particular adjustment procedures. Correct machine calibration ensures constant character formation and spacing, optimizing readability. Usually examine character wheels and hanging mechanisms for put on or injury.
Tip 4: Constant Strain Utility: Uniform strain ensures clear and even embossing. Inconsistent strain can result in illegible characters or untimely tag put on. Sustaining constant strain all through the embossing course of ensures uniform character depth and enhances tag sturdiness. Usually check the machine’s strain settings to make sure optimum efficiency.
Tip 5: Common Upkeep: Routine cleansing and lubrication of the machine’s shifting elements forestall malfunctions and lengthen its operational lifespan. Seek the advice of the producer’s suggestions for particular upkeep procedures. Correct upkeep ensures constant efficiency and prolongs the machine’s operational life.
Tip 6: Correct Storage of Tags and Blanks: Retailer clean and embossed tags in a clear, dry atmosphere to forestall corrosion or injury. Correct storage preserves tag integrity and ensures long-term readability. Keep away from storing tags in humid or corrosive environments.
Tip 7: Take a look at Embossing High quality: Periodically check embossing high quality on pattern tags. This permits for early detection of potential points with the machine or supplies. Common high quality checks assist preserve constant tag legibility and establish potential issues earlier than they have an effect on operational utilization.
